If you got a Summons and Complaint, you need to deliver a written Answer form to the plaintiff and the Court. Your Answer is what you tell the court about what the plaintiff said in the Complaint. The Answer tells the court your defenses or reasons the plaintiff must not win the case.

A suit to obtain 2[a decree] that a mortgagor shall be absolutely debarred of his right to redeem the mortgaged property is called a suit for foreclosure.
Under a judicial foreclosure proceeding, the lender files suit with the court to initiate foreclosure?typically after the borrower misses their third consecutive mortgage payment (also known as going 90 days past due on their loan).
